GROW BAG AND DRAINAGE COLLECTION CHANNEL FOR TOMATO CULTIVATION IN MEDIUM-TECH GREENHOUSES
Soil channel and drainage spacer to collect the water drained from the crop and be able to reuse it.
Design, manufacture and technical support during the implementation of a substrate-drainage channel system for tomato and bell pepper cultivation adapted to variable climates and medium technology greenhouses.
